在计算机图形学和3D渲染领域,Z通道是一个至关重要的概念,它不仅影响着画面的深度信息,还直接关系到最终的视觉效果是否具有真实感。接下来,我们就来一起揭开Z通道的神秘面纱,探索它是如何工作的。
Z通道的基本原理
首先,我们需要了解Z通道的基本原理。在3D渲染中,每个像素点都有一个对应的Z值,这个Z值代表了该像素点在3D场景中的深度。简单来说,Z值越小,像素点离摄像机越近;Z值越大,像素点离摄像机越远。
这个Z值是如何产生的呢?在3D场景渲染过程中,每个物体上的点都会被投射到摄像机所在的二维平面上。当这些点被投射到二维平面上后,计算机就会计算出每个像素点对应的Z值。这个计算过程通常是通过光线投射和几何变换来实现的。
Z通道在渲染中的作用
Z通道在渲染过程中扮演着至关重要的角色,以下是它在几个关键环节的作用:
1. 深度排序
在3D渲染中,场景中的物体通常不是按照实际距离来渲染的。为了实现这种效果,计算机需要将场景中的物体按照距离摄像机的远近进行排序。Z通道就是实现这一功能的关键。通过对Z值进行排序,计算机可以确定哪些物体应该先被渲染,哪些物体应该后被渲染。
2. 深度混合
深度混合是一种渲染技术,它可以让渲染出的画面更加真实。这种技术利用Z通道信息,在两个物体之间进行透明度计算。例如,如果一个物体部分遮挡了另一个物体,那么计算机就会根据Z值计算遮挡部分和被遮挡部分的透明度,从而实现深度混合效果。
3. 景深效果
景深是摄影和电影中常见的视觉效果,它可以让画面中的某些物体显得更加清晰,而其他物体则显得模糊。在3D渲染中,Z通道同样可以用来实现景深效果。通过调整Z通道中的值,计算机可以模拟出不同焦距下的画面效果。
Z通道与真实感
Z通道对于渲染真实感画面至关重要。以下是几个方面说明了Z通道如何影响真实感:
1. 光照效果
光照是影响画面真实感的重要因素之一。在3D渲染中,Z通道可以帮助计算机更准确地模拟光照效果。例如,当计算反射和折射时,Z通道可以确保光线正确地传播到场景中的各个物体上。
2. 模糊效果
模糊效果是模拟真实世界中的视觉现象,如空气散射、镜头畸变等。在3D渲染中,Z通道可以帮助计算机更精确地实现这些效果,从而提高画面的真实感。
3. 深度混合与景深
如前所述,深度混合和景深效果可以让画面中的某些物体更加突出,而其他物体则显得更加模糊。这些效果对于营造真实感画面至关重要,而Z通道则是实现这些效果的基础。
总结
Z通道是3D渲染中不可或缺的一部分,它对于渲染真实感画面具有重要意义。通过了解Z通道的基本原理、作用以及它在渲染过程中的应用,我们可以更好地掌握3D渲染技术,创作出更加精彩的视觉效果。
